There are a variety of ways to start a business, the most common of which will be the sole proprietor. In this instance the owner and also the company are seen as one legal entity. This means that if a claim is made against your business the claim is actually lodged towards you as well. In the event the company goes under then your property is going to be forfeit along with the business property to pay all the financial obligations that the company might have built up. This can be very problematic if you don't have insurance coverage and the business is not really making any money yet as you will end up being liable for any expenses and repairs that have to be done.
There are a lot of various types of insurance for business. There is something to cover just about any kind of situation.
If you wish to cover yourself against lawsuits you will want legal insurance for business. This is available but it is more expensive than legal cover for a person. This kind of insurance coverage will cover you against lawsuits by helping you to get legal advice and steer clear of the actual legal cases to begin with as well as legal representation in case a lawsuit is placed against you.
Then there is the insurance for business that covers the actual assets of the company. This is an excellent idea because mishaps do happen and expensive gear can be ruined and fires can happen. If the should happen with no foul play on your part can be seen then you will be able to repair the equipment or rebuild your building from the claim on your insurance policy.
Then there's public liability which is a type of legal cover and protects you against having to pay exorbitant claims out of your pocket. If a person makes a legitimate claim against your company then you can pay them by making a claim on your public liability insurance policy.
